Mission San Juan Capistrano is open daily, Monday through Sunday from 9:00 a.m. - 5:00 p.m., closed Thanksgiving and Christmas and closes at noon on Christmas Eve and Good Friday.
What other places around the mission are there to visit?
A:
The little town has Antique shops , boutique s and many restaurants. If you cross the railroad tracks to the “ Rios” section there is a Tea room , Coffee House , cafes and Art …
The little town has Antique shops , boutique s and many restaurants. If you cross the railroad tracks to the “ Rios” section there is a Tea room , Coffee House , cafes and Art Galleries, very quaint and historic part of SJC ...
